Common questions

How many calories are in Prunes?

Prunes by Ella's kitchen has 71 kcal per 100 g. One serving (70 g) is about 50 kcal.

How much protein is in Prunes?

Prunes contains 0.6 g of protein per 100 g — about 0.4 g per 70 g serving.

Is Prunes high in carbs?

Yes — carbohydrates provide 90% of its calories (15.6 g per 100 g, of which 11.1 g is sugar). It also delivers 2.1 g of fiber.

Is Prunes low in sodium?

Yes — just 8 mg per 100 g (0% of the daily value), which qualifies as low sodium.

Why does Prunes have a Nutri-Score of B?

Nutri-Score weighs negatives (calories, sugar, saturated fat, sodium) against positives (fiber, protein) per 100 g. Points against come from sugar (11.1 g). Overall that places it in band B.

How much Prunes is 100 calories?

About 141 g of Prunes equals 100 kcal. It is a relatively low energy-density food, so portions can be generous.

Is Prunes a good source of potassium?

It is a moderate source: 610 mg per 100 g, about 13% of the daily value. A 200 g portion covers roughly 26%.

Is Prunes high in sugar or fat?

Per 100 g it has 11.1 g sugar and 0.5 g fat (0.5 g saturated). Fat provides 7% of its calories, so portion size matters most here.
